Transaction 316546be0d7f10b80f7729fcfa6b31e50f1f5a48feaafea92212bcb68858fa62
1 Input
1 Output
-
316546be0d7f10b80f7729fcfa6b31e50f1f5a48feaafea92212bcb68858fa62:0
- value
- 110284245
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f2563643563b6fb507d36b18f95b86c20fe58f4
- address
- bc1qrujkxep4vwm0k5rax6ccl9dcdss0uk85pe2je6